<b>The <i>New York Times </i>#1 best-selling series. <br></b><br>Like its predecessors <i>Library of Souls</i> blends thrilling fantasy with never-before-published vintage photography to create a one-of-a-kind reading experience<b>.</b><br> <b> </b><br> A boy with extraordinary powers. An army of deadly monsters. An epic battle for the future of peculiardom.<br>  <br> The adventure that began with <i>Miss Peregrine’s Home for Peculiar Children</i> and continued in <i>Hollow City</i> comes to a thrilling conclusion with <i>Library of Souls</i>. As the story opens sixteen-year-old Jacob discovers a powerful new ability and soon he’s diving through history to rescue his peculiar companions from a heavily guarded fortress. Accompanying Jacob on his journey are Emma Bloom a girl with fire at her fingertips and Addison MacHenry a dog with a nose for sniffing out lost children.<br>  <br> They’ll travel from modern-day London to the labyrinthine alleys of Devil’s Acre the most wretched slum in all of Victorian England. It’s a place where the fate of peculiar children everywhere will be decided once and for all.
